“Thomas Graham WARE, five-year-old son of Mr. and Mrs. C.G. Ware of the Coiltown section, who formerly lived near Providence, died Tuesday, June 30, following a two-day illness of colitis. He was being brought to Providence for medical treatment and died enroute. Survivors besides the parents are four brothers, Billy, Joe, Jimmy and Dannie; five sisters, Wanda, Carolyn, Linda, Sandra, and Brenda; and grandmothers Mrs. Sibbie Ware of Clay and Mrs. Agnes RUSSELBERG of Morganfield. Funeral services were held at 2 p.m. Thursday at Rose Creek Cumberland Presbyterian Church, with the Rev. R.T. MITCHELL of Providence officiating. Burial was in I.O.O.F. cemetery at Boxville. Providence Journal-Enterprise, Thursday, July 9, 1953.”
Source: The Providence Journal-Enterprise, 1948 – 1961
